AceShowbiz - Hit film franchise The Sisterhood of the Traveling Pants is set to become the latest film adapted for a new stage musical.

Blake Lively, Amber Tamblyn, America Ferrera, and Alexis Bledel starred as best friends preparing to spend their first summer apart in the 2005 movie and its sequel, The Sisterhood of the Traveling Pants 2, in 2008, and now the story is set for a curtain call.

Scott Delman will produce the project for Blue Spruce Productions after obtaining the live theatrical rights, according to Variety.

Casting details and an expected launch date have yet to be announced.

The films were originally based on author Ann Brashares' young adult series of the same name.

The news of the stageshow emerges as rumours of a third movie continue to rumble. In April, Bledel admitted all four actresses are keen to reunite onscreen, explaining, "We just pitched the third movie. I hope it comes together".
